What Does “Best Version of You” Even Mean?
First things first, let’s ditch the cookie-cutter definition. Being your best self isn’t about fitting into some perfect mold. It’s not about being a millionaire, a fitness guru, or a social media star (unless that’s genuinely your dream!).
Instead, it’s about:
Authenticity: Are you living in alignment with your core values? Are you true to yourself, even when it’s tough?
Growth: Are you continuously learning and evolving? Are you challenging yourself to step outside your comfort zone?
Well-being: Are you taking care of your physical and mental health? Are you prioritizing your happiness and peace of mind?
Purpose: Are you finding meaning in what you do? Are you contributing to something bigger than yourself?
It’s a deeply personal journey. What makes you feel fulfilled and alive will be different from what drives someone else.
Signs You Might Not Be Your Best Self (And That’s Okay!)
We all have our off days, weeks, and sometimes even months. But if you’re consistently experiencing these signs, it might be time for a little self-reflection:
Constant comparison: Are you always comparing yourself to others on social media or in real life?
Lack of passion: Do you feel uninspired and unmotivated in your daily life?
Negative self-talk: Are you constantly putting yourself down and focusing on your flaws?
Avoiding challenges: Are you staying in your comfort zone and avoiding opportunities for growth?
Ignoring your needs: Are you neglecting your physical and mental health?
If any of these resonate, don’t panic! It’s a sign that you’re human, and it’s a fantastic opportunity for growth.
How to Start Becoming Your Best Self (Today!)
Here are some actionable steps you can take:
Self-Reflection:
Journaling: Write down your thoughts, feelings, and goals.
Meditation: Take a few minutes each day to quiet your mind.
Ask yourself tough questions: What are my values? What brings me joy? What do I want to achieve?
Set Realistic Goals:
Break down big goals into smaller, manageable steps.
Celebrate your progress along the way.
Prioritize Self-Care:
Make time for activities that nourish your mind and body.
Get enough sleep, eat healthy, and exercise regularly.
Embrace Growth:
Step outside your comfort zone and try new things.
Learn from your mistakes and view them as opportunities for growth.
Cultivate Positive Relationships:
Surround yourself with people who support and inspire you.
Let go of toxic relationships that drain your energy.
